Job description

We are seeking an outstanding Business Teacher who can also work with the VP for Quality of Education and the Teaching and Learning team to lead the Digital Strategy to support the work towards reducing workload and improving standards. You will work with Trust level colleagues in shaping and delivering the strategy. You will be expected to plan and deliver high-quality lessons that enable students to develop a deep understanding of Business while building their confidence and problem-solving skills.

You will play an important role in educating and inspiring students to understand fundamental concepts and principles in business and entrepreneurship. This is an exciting opportunity to become part of a collaborative and supportive team that values creativity, high standards, and an innovative approach to Business and entrepreneurship.
